Job Summary
As an Embedded Software Engineer, you will be instrumental in developing embedded software for mechatronic systems within the automotive sector, adhering to Automotive SPICE standards. Your daily tasks will involve implementing functions using C code, configuring Autosar components, and integrating and commissioning software on control units. You will also be responsible for managing software releases, creating necessary documentation, and coordinating both internal and external development efforts. This role requires you to develop and track requirements, and design software architectures and module designs.
